Output 3c47b0b7f5c792b1857c2083fdccae26d3784a8a2de932f33edb4dd2fbd09e17:0

value
21037529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8da44e4c6e87e00b6a0057aafa53e444253fccac OP_EQUAL
address
3Ebx2mBykTp2HkmMgexR2DWz1rW8E13r1T
transaction
3c47b0b7f5c792b1857c2083fdccae26d3784a8a2de932f33edb4dd2fbd09e17
spent
true